什么時候傾向于選擇redis?業(yè)務(wù)需求決定技術(shù)選型,當(dāng)業(yè)務(wù)有這樣一些特點的時候,選擇redis會更加適合。 復(fù)雜數(shù)據(jù)結(jié)構(gòu)value是哈希,列表,...
Cache Aside Pattern(旁路緩存模式)對于讀請求先讀cache,再讀db如果,cache hit,則直接返回數(shù)據(jù)如果,cache...
問:KV緩存都緩存了一些什么數(shù)據(jù)?答:(1)樸素類型的數(shù)據(jù),例如:int(2)序列化后的對象,例如:User實體,本質(zhì)是binary(3)文本數(shù)...
容錯設(shè)計又叫彈力設(shè)計,其中著眼于分布式系統(tǒng)的各種“容忍”能力,包括容錯能力(服務(wù) 隔離、異步調(diào)用、請求冪等性)、可伸縮性(有 / 無狀態(tài)的服務(wù))...
1.棧的特點:棧也是一種線性結(jié)構(gòu);相比數(shù)組,棧所對應(yīng)的操作是數(shù)組的子集;棧只能從一端添加元素,也只能從這一端取出元素,這一端通常稱之為"棧頂";...
1 優(yōu)先隊列(Priority Queue)優(yōu)先隊列與普通隊列的區(qū)別:普通隊列遵循先進(jìn)先出的原則;優(yōu)先隊列的出隊順序與入隊順序無關(guān),與優(yōu)先級相關(guān)...
1.整型哈希函數(shù)的設(shè)計小范圍正整數(shù)直接使用小范圍負(fù)整數(shù)整體進(jìn)行偏移大整數(shù),通常做法是"模一個素數(shù)" 2.浮點型哈希函數(shù)的設(shè)計轉(zhuǎn)成整型進(jìn)行處理 3...
二叉樹跟鏈表一樣,二叉樹也是一種動態(tài)數(shù)據(jù)結(jié)構(gòu),即,不需要在創(chuàng)建時指定大小。跟鏈表不同的是,二叉樹中的每個節(jié)點,除了要存放元素e,它還有兩個指向其...
Java并發(fā)工具類的三板斧 狀態(tài),隊列,CAS 狀態(tài): 隊列:在FutureTask中,隊列的實現(xiàn)是一個單向鏈表,它表示所有等待任務(wù)執(zhí)行完畢的線...